The Largs Viking Festival is set to kick off on Saturday with a spectacular opening parade. 

The spectacle will feature impressive floats with members of community groups, organisations - and of course Scandinavian warriors of yore - taking part.

Other event highlights will include Ayrshire Classic Cars, the wee longboat, vintage tractors, and even a steam engine.

The parade kicks off at Morrisons Supermarket at 1pm and heads through the town centre out towards Barrfields Park.

The Largs Viking Festival returns in a blaze of glory, with an exciting schedule of events from across two weekends, from September 2 to 10.

It includes all the usual favourites including the opening parade, Viking Village entertainment stage, food and craft market, and The Festival of Fire.
